Transaction ea510929476e3b695f376fb56b3b5c9ea1daa95318c407f07dfb797de9196020
1 Input
1 Output
-
ea510929476e3b695f376fb56b3b5c9ea1daa95318c407f07dfb797de9196020:0
- value
- 558451
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d80e1ac9ecf923bf2d8db61b69ae367933bf38c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LhPrShtzBVLgu3NvADhPKS5xbRU63zfjS